The Lord’s Prayer E-mail Print PDF Lk 11:1-4 1[Jesus] was praying in a certain place, and when he had finished, one of his disciples said to him, “Lord, teach us to pray just as John taught his disciples.” 2He said to them, “When you pray, say: Father, hallowed be your name, your kingdom come. 3Give us each day our daily bread 4and forgive us our sins for we ourselves forgive everyone in debt to us, and do not subject us to the final test.” Reflection: Lord, teach us to pray. The disciples make this request because they frequently see Jesus praying. Often we do not know how to pray. In fact, of ourselves, we cannot pray as we should. Jesus does not only give us the “Our Father” as a model of our prayer. He also gives us his Spirit. Blessed Teresa of Calcutta, when consulted by the Asian bishops during one of their meetings held in Calcutta, spoke of Christian prayer as letting Jesus pray in us and through us. Hence, when we want to pray, let us ask Jesus, “Pray in me, Jesus. Send your Holy Spirit to me so that he may enable me to unite myself to you in prayer.” Jesus himself assures us that where two or three are gathered together in his name, he is there in the midst of them (cf Mt 18:20).
